The video starts with SO-50. WD9EWK was roving in two grids, so I spent most of the time listening. I always give way to the rovers so they can get all the contacts. Because I know how it feels to pack up the gear, go to some usually out of the way spot, find grid lines and then operate outside! It’s tough on FM, especially when the guys sitting at home with stations like mine hog the pass. Great job Patrick!!

Next is a low eastern pass of Russian Linear Satellite RS-44.

Then Tevel, which sounded beautiful once it came in!

And rounded out by the second pass of RS-44.

I did record the pass of SO-121 Hades-D, but I will probably just turn that into a short. That satellite has such a small window of opportunity it doesn’t really warrant more than a short. It is neat because it’s so hard to hear. The thing is only putting out something like .250 watt!!!!
